Sat 398038524959136

decimal
79607.3524959136
degree
0°79607′983″3524959136‴
percentile
18.954215495094218%
name
lalbopsptft
cycle
0
epoch
0
period
39
block
79607
offset
3524959136
timestamp
rarity
common